Title: | phpMyAdmin Setup Script Request Cross Site Scripting Vulnerability |
Summary: | phpMyAdmin is prone to a c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ability. |
Description: | Summary: phpMyAdmin is prone to a c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ability. Vulnerability Insight: The flaw is caused by an unspecified input validation error when processing spoofed requests sent to setup script, which could be exploited by attackers to cause arbitrary scripting code to be executed on the user's browser session in the security context of an affected site. Vulnerability Impact: Successful exploitation will allow attackers to execute arbitrary web script or HTML in a user's browser session in the context of an affected site. Affected Software/OS: phpMyAdmin versions 3.x before 3.3.7 Solution: Upgrade to phpMyAdmin version 3.3.7 or later. CVSS Score: 4.3 CVSS Vector: AV:N/AC:M/Au:N/C:N/I:P/A:N |
